Abstract
It is demonstrated that the MBER criterion can adjust the weights of the beamforming more intelligently than the traditional MMSE criterion to reduce the bit error rate. This thesis researches on the MBER criterion and the adaptive MBER algorithm. We compare the difference between the MBER criterion and the MMSE criterion by showing the simulation results.
Multiple antenna arrays are often used to overcome the effect of channel fading which is caused by multipath interference. In chapters 4 and 5 ,we derive spatial correlation equations of ULA ,UCA and CRA for two types of angular spread distributions (uniform distribution and truncated Gaussian distribution).We also compare the difference between these antenna arrays by showing the bit error rate simulation results and discuss the relationship between BER and spatial correlation. In a multi-user mobile radio environment , we present simulation results to show that adaptive MBER algorithms have better performance than the traditional MMSE algorithm.
